.post-module__RgGjbW__main{background:var(--black);min-height:100vh;color:var(--white);padding-top:140px;padding-bottom:8rem}.post-module__RgGjbW__container{max-width:680px;margin:0 auto;padding:0 2rem}.post-module__RgGjbW__back{color:var(--grey-dim);margin-bottom:2rem;font-size:.9rem;text-decoration:none;transition:color .2s;display:inline-block}.post-module__RgGjbW__back:hover{color:var(--white)}.post-module__RgGjbW__heading{letter-spacing:-.02em;margin-bottom:.5rem;font-size:2.5rem;font-weight:700;line-height:1.2}.post-module__RgGjbW__date{color:var(--grey-dim);letter-spacing:.05em;margin-bottom:2.5rem;font-size:.85rem;display:block}.post-module__RgGjbW__imageWrap{border:1px solid var(--border);border-radius:4px;margin-bottom:3rem;overflow:hidden}.post-module__RgGjbW__image{width:100%;height:auto;display:block}.post-module__RgGjbW__content p{color:var(--grey);margin-bottom:1.5rem;font-size:1.05rem;line-height:1.9}.post-module__RgGjbW__content h2{color:var(--white);letter-spacing:-.01em;margin:2.5rem 0 1rem;font-size:1.4rem;font-weight:600}.post-module__RgGjbW__content em{font-style:italic}.post-module__RgGjbW__content hr{border:none;border-top:1px solid var(--border);margin:3rem 0}.post-module__RgGjbW__content a{color:var(--white);border-bottom:1px solid var(--grey-dim);text-decoration:none}.post-module__RgGjbW__content a:hover{border-color:var(--white)}@media (max-width:768px){.post-module__RgGjbW__main{padding-top:100px;padding-bottom:4rem}.post-module__RgGjbW__heading{font-size:1.75rem}.post-module__RgGjbW__content h2{font-size:1.2rem}.post-module__RgGjbW__content p{font-size:1rem}}
